CADDY® Mille-Tie™Print this page

The CADDY Mille-Tie from ERICO is the 21st century method of quickly and economically bundling and positioning high-performance copper and fiber cable. It also works with power cables, conduit and innerduct in cable trays, non-continuous fasteners (J-Hooks, etc.), surface raceways, wireways, service poles and in-wall cabling. The Mille-Tie separates cables for voice, data, video, alarm and building automation systems in horizontal and backbone pathways, simplifying installation and identification for testing and troubleshooting.

Features

  • Protects cables from crimping with "Intelligent Grip Technology"
  • Cushions vibrations
  • Maintains cable properties and conductor configuration
  • No waste, simply cut and use remaining tie
  • Reusable
  • No sharp edges
  • One size fits all
  • 12 inches long

How It Works

  1. Fit the Mille-Tie by threading the tongue through the last available cell.
  2. Carefully pull the tie snug and remove any excess strip.
  3. Reuse this shorter Mille-Tie until it runs out.
  4. A Mille-Tie strip may be used for three or four ties, depending on the application.

Remove and Reuse

  1. Fit Mille-Tie as normal but do not remove the remaining strip.
  2. Instead reverse-thread the tongue through the same latching cell.
  3. Pull the Mille-Tie half-way through for a quick-release system.
  4. Pull all the way through to release.
  5. Removed Mille-Ties can be kept and reused as required.

Details by Region: North and Latin America

North and Latin America

  • Available in two versions - suitable for air-handling spaces (Plenum) and Low Smoke/Zero Halogen Certified

Catalog No. Description Qty per Bag/Box
CATMTP Red CADDY Mille-Tie (suitable for air-handling spaces) 100/1000
CATMTLS Yellow CADDY Mille-Tie (Low Smoke - Zero Halogen) 100/1000
